How do we find great power to get things done? The early church found great power to testify to the death of Christ to pay for sin and the bodily resurrecti­on of Christ to defeat sin and death once and for all.

They used that great power to testify and reach others for Christ. We can learn from them and find great power for our endeavors today!

The answer to our query about how to find great power to get things done is in Acts 4:32-33, “(32) Now the full number of those who believed were of one heart and soul, and no one said that any of the things that belonged to him was his own, but they had everything in common. (33) And with great power the apostles were giving their testimony to the power of the Lord Jesus, and great grace was upon them all.” (ESV)

It’s imperative we see the unity the believers had in this early history of the church. Noticethe full number of the people who were believers were of one heart and one soul. They were so unified they considered all their possession­s the property of one another. This attitude of oneness wasn’t imposed by some human power but emerged from the power that came from God! There’s amazing power when a group of people find unity of purpose!

Notice great power was on the people and that led to great achievemen­t of their mission to testify to the resurrecti­on of Christ and impact others for Him! Great unity led to great power and that led to tremendous achievemen­t in their mission! Where did that unity and power come from?

The unity and power came from one source and that source was that great grace was upon them all! The word “grace” means favor with God that’s not deserved but is just granted by Him! Notice that what was upon them wasn’t just grace, but great grace! God dumped an abundance of that grace on His people and they overachiev­ed!

Those early believers set out to testify to Christ and bring people of their own free will to Christ. In Acts 2:41, 3,000 people came to Christ on the Day of Pentecost in A.D. 33! In Acts 2:47 the text says people were added to the number of the Disciples day by day, in other words people responded to Christ and believed in Him every day! Acts 5:14 indicates “multitudes” of people came to Christ! Then Acts 6:7 says the number of the disciples multiplied! The testimony of the early disciples was successful in the extreme! The key to such success is the power of God from extreme unity and that by God granting His grace in the hyper extreme!

Success in anything comes from power expressing itself in unity of purpose among people and God granting His grace to that endeavor! In fact, I’ve concluded the necessary unity of purpose among people comes from God’s grace as does the power to achieve great things! Grace from God is the necessary element!
